Winter's Moon


















I stare out my window tonight,
The cold moon gives off a strange light.
Its so mournful I heard it sigh,
Setting up there so very high.

I know that sigh, I know it well,
Within my heart it mutely dwells.
A sigh can be a lovely thing,
Sometimes it makes you want to sing.

Somewhere, some place there is some one,
Looking at the moon just for fun.
Tonight we are together free,
That's a very good way to be.

Tomorrow's dawn will shine anew,
I wonder how life is with you.
The one who watched the moon with me,
With poet's thoughts we both agree.

Will we be poets come daybreak,
Or has it all been one more fake?
Will we pick up our guns and fire,
Your god and mine are just for hire.
